Which door is assigned to the N3 during an evacuation on land?

The N3 evacuation position is associated with the R2 door. During an evacuation on land, the N3 is primarily responsible for ensuring that passengers exit safely from the aircraft via this particular door. The rationale for assigning the N3 to the R2 door includes factors such as proximity to the cabin's emergency exits and the operational flow of passenger egress. The R2 door provides a clear and accessible route for passengers, minimizing the potential for congestion during an evacuation. It is crucial for the N3 to be familiar with the equipment and procedures related to the R2 door, as they play a vital role in facilitating a swift and orderly exit in emergency situations. This understanding directly contributes to the safety and efficiency of the evacuation process as a whole.
